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6866 43401110 09903798640 2949 9863
46 904424 90099
46 904424 90099
38181 262152 990599
All about undefined
Interested in learning more?
46 904424 90099
38181 262152 990599
See more
24643077 45534
31496 10593 846359916
See more
6878 1163414
167705216 18 61552579
See more